university Vacancies THE UNIVERSITY OF PAPUA NEW GUINEA (PORT MORESBY) LECTURER/SENIOR LECTURER IN ANIMAL NUTRITION IN AGRICULTURE APPLICATIONS are invited for the position of Lecturer/ Senior Lecturer in Animal Nutrition in the Department of Agriculture. Applicants should have a good first deigree in Agriculture or Veterjinary Science, together with I post-graduate experience in i Animal Nutrition and BioI chemistry, preferably at the IPh.D. level. Preference will ;be given to applicants with ■University teaching and research experience in tropical i agriculture. : The appointee will be responsible for courses in Biochemistry and Animal Nutrition up'to Honours Degree level and may be required to (assist in other courses according to experience and interest. The appointee will be expected to supervise postgraduates and to pursue independent research. The appointee may also be asked to assist with animal production projects on the Departmental Farm and to undertake other relevant duties as may be assigned from time to time. Currently the Department of Agriculture is split be-; tween Port Moresby and Lae,; but the intention in the near: future, is to unify the Depart-, ment. In the first instance, the appointee will be located In Lae. i SALARY’: I Lecturer Grade I: K 12,810■ per annum plus gratuity. Lecturer Grade II: K 14,660 per annum plus grauity. Senior Lecturer: K 16,510 per annum plus gratuity. Applications should include 'a detailed curriculum vitae, a recent small photograph and the names and addresses lof three referees. I The successful applicant ■will be offered a contract for a three-year appointment. The gratuity entitlement is based on 24 per cent of sal■arv earned and is payable in ■instalments or lump sum and is taxed at a flat rate of 2 .per cent. In addition to the salaries quoted above, the I main benefits include: supIport for approved research; ! rent-free accommodation; appointment and repatriation ■air fares for appointee and ‘dependants, financial assistance towards the cost of transporting personal effects to and from P.N.G., 6 weeks annual recreation leave with home air fares available after each 18 months of continuousj service: generous education subsidies for children for attending schools in P.N.G. or overseas; a salary continuation scheme to cover extended illness or disability. Applicants who wish to arrange secondment from their home institutions will be welcomed. EXPERIENCED MARRIED MAN REQUIRED for North Canterbury deer and cattle property 50 miles north of Christchurch on State Highway I at Greta Valley, Motunau. Applicants to be capable of handling the cattle side with tractor work kept to a minimum. Full range of plant kept for big round bales hay system and for maintenance of tracks, etc. No cropping. Applicants to be experienced in all phases of mechanical and general stock work. The position carries a measure of responsibility with a 3 bedroom summerhill stone house alongside the ’ Greta Valley Primary School. High school bus at corner. High wages will be paid to a good man by negotiation. Apply: D. E. ROBERTSON. Tipapa, Greta Valiev. Amberley 3 R.D., Phone Scargill 814 (collect).
